I would like to hear, from a scriptural position, what you think of all the images of Christ. They never bothered me until recently when I read Exodus 20:4-5 "Thou shalt not make unto thee any graven image, or any likeness of anything that is in heaven above, or that is in the earth beneath, or that is in the water under the earth: Thou shalt not bow down thyself to them, nor serve them..." And put that with John 20:29, "Jesus saith unto him, Thomas, because thou hast seen Me, thou hast believed: blessed are they that have not seen, and yet have believed." I get that paintings of Christ may not be biblical. We have not seen Christ bodily so to make a picture of almighty God seems to be idolatry. Not to mention the fact that Jesus gives a blessing in John for those that have not seen Him and yet believe. My point is that maybe paintings and pictures of God bring Him down to our level, taking away from His majesty.
